Discover LudwigThe phrase "are commonly split into"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when describing how a particular subject or concept is divided into different categories or parts.
Example: "The data sets are commonly split into training, validation, and test sets for machine learning purposes."
Alternatives: "are often divided into" or "are typically categorized into".
